Our curricula offers students the skills needed in business, while balancing them with their own interests and career goals. The agribusiness degree has three options: agribusiness, food industry economics, and international. The agricultural economics major has three options: specialty, farm management, and quantitative. Two pre-professional programs (pre-law and pre-vet) are available under the specialty option, as well as an option with emphasis on natural resources and environmental sciences.
